These last 2 images are not wedding albums, but rather the ever-so-popular Guest Book Album.  I use images from a couple's engagement session and put them in a hardback, coffee-table-style album for guests to sign at the wedding, instead of the traditional guest album of blank lines that usually ends up stored somewhere, rarely (if ever) to be seen again.




This guest book doubles as a photo album as well, so you can leave it out for everyone to see. I leave blank areas throughout the album for wedding guests to sign and write well-wishes. Fun!
